The massacre of the Levi family, of which only adopted twins Eva and Greta survive, pits priests Father Michel and Father Paul against the powers of evil, both convinced that the twins are diabolical.
There are no TV Airings of Twins in the next 14 days.
Add Twins to your Watchlist to find out when it's coming back.
Check if it is available to stream online via "Where to Watch".